remains one of the most enduring figures in popular fiction, evolving from a 1912 magazine story into a global multi-media franchise spanning over 52 authorized films and numerous television series. Created by Edgar Rice Burroughs, the character represents a "daydream figure" that allows audiences to escape the confines of civilization. 1. Tarzan remains a fascinating case study in popular media. He is a character that Hollywood cannot kill, yet struggles to modernize.
